Before we can bridge the gaps in our teams, families, and communities, we have to address the gap within ourselves. In a world filled with constant noise, how do we maintain clarity, peace, and balance?
Join host Dr. Keith Haney as he sits down with Erin Treacy to talk about the power of emotional intelligence in modern leadership. Erin shares her journey through a life-altering health scare that taught her the critical necessity of slowing down and prioritizing self-care. Tune in to learn why connection with others begins with connection to self, and how taking intentional micro-breaks can help you lead with empathy, resilience, and grace.
Takeaways:
In a world filled with noise, reconnecting with ourselves is crucial for clarity and balance in our daily lives.
Ignoring our body’s signals can lead to burnout, so we should prioritize self-care and listen to our needs.
Effective leadership is all about connection; understanding the people we work with makes all the difference in fostering a positive environment.
Two minutes of intentional unplugging can have a profound impact on our day, allowing us to regain focus and clarity.
